摘要
Multilayer lithium tantalate thin films have been successfully prepared on Pt/Ti/SiO2/Si(100) substrate using sol-gel and spin-coating method. Polycrystalline perovskite films were obtained through pyrolysis at 400 degrees C and subsequent calcination at various temperatures from 500 degrees C to 700 degrees C for 1h, which were optimized by means of X-ray diffraction, Raman spectroscopy and thermal analysis. The morphology on the top surface and fractured cross section of LT films was observed by a field-emission scanning electron microscope. The 300 nm thick LT film annealed at 650 degrees C exhibited a dielectric constant of 19.8 and a loss tangent of 0.06 at 10KHz.
